Understanding Clinical Trials

What Are Clinical Trials?

Clinical trials are research studies that are aimed at evaluating a medical, surgical, or behavioral intervention. They are the primary way that researchers discover whether new treatments are safe and effective in humans.

Before a new treatment is brought to market, it must undergo a series of clinical trials to ensure it is both safe for widespread use and effective in treating the condition it targets.

Clinical trials play a pivotal role in medical research, serving as the foundation upon which new therapies and medical procedures are built. These trials are categorized into different phases, each designed to answer specific research questions about the new treatment.

From early-stage trials (Phase 1) that assess safety and dosage to later-stage trials (Phase 3) that compare the new treatment against current standard treatments, each phase is crucial in the development of medical interventions.

Types of Clinical Trials

While clinical trials can be conducted for a wide range of diseases and conditions, lung cancer research is among the most critical areas of study. Given the complexity and variability of cancer, clinical trials in this field are particularly vital. They encompass a broad spectrum of studies, including:
  • Small Cell and Non-Small Cell Lung Cancer Trials: These trials focus on investigating treatments for the two main types of lung cancer, each of which behaves and responds to treatment differently.
  • Stage-Specific Trials: Certain trials are designed to test treatments for specific stages of cancer, such as stage 3 or stage 4 lung cancer, providing targeted insights into the disease's progression and treatment efficacy.
  • Cancer Vaccine Trials: These innovative trials explore the potential of vaccines to prevent or treat cancer, representing a cutting-edge area of cancer research.

The Challenge of Finding the Right Trial

The Complexity of Clinical Trial Searches

Finding the right clinical trial can be a daunting challenge, especially for individuals dealing with complex conditions like lung cancer. The journey to finding a trial that not only matches an individual's specific medical condition but is also geographically accessible can be overwhelming.

This process involves navigating through an extensive amount of medical information, understanding eligibility criteria, and often, dealing with the frustration of discovering that a seemingly suitable trial is located too far away.

For those living with lung cancer, the stakes are even higher. The disease's aggressive nature and the myriad of subtypes and stages mean that the search for an appropriate clinical trial is not just about finding any trial, but the right one.

It requires time, effort, and a deep understanding of both the disease and the research landscape—a combination that many individuals find themselves unequipped to handle alone.

Potential Benefits and Considerations

Understanding Trial Benefits

Participating in a clinical trial offers the potential for numerous benefits, including access to new treatments that are not yet available to the public. These trials provide a critical pathway to receiving potentially life-saving therapies and contributing to the advancement of medical research.

While some trials may offer compensation, travel arrangements, or stipends, it's important to understand that these should not be the primary motivation for participation. The main focus should always be on the potential health benefits and the opportunity to contribute to medical science.
